누구에게 적합한가요?

장비 제공업체
그리퍼, 전동 드라이버, 프로토콜 컨버터 등 타사 장비 제공업체는 설정을 간소화하는 맞춤형 인터페이스를 제공하여 사용자가 애플리케이션 개발을 가속화하고 전반적인 효율성을 높일 수 있도록 지원할 수 있습니다.

애플리케이션 서비스 제공업체
용접, 적재, 머신 텐딩과 같은 애플리케이션의 경우, 서비스 제공업체는 노하우를 사용자 친화적인 인터페이스에 통합할 수 있습니다. 이를 통해 최종 사용자는 애플리케이션을 더 직관적이고 편리하게 설정 및 조정할 수 있어 사용성이 향상되고 더 큰 유연성을 제공받을 수 있습니다.
어떤 종류의 플러그인을 개발할 수 있나요?
TMcraft Node
TMcraft Node는 개발자가 TMflow 프로젝트 내에서 사용할 커스텀 노드를 생성할 수 있도록 지원하는 다목적 플러그인 아키텍처(C# 및 WPF 기반)입니다. 각 TMcraft Node는 사용자 인터페이스(UI)와 스크립트 해석이라는 두 가지 핵심 구성 요소로 이루어져 있습니다. UI를 통해 사용자는 특정 요구 사항에 맞는 설정을 쉽게 구성할 수 있습니다. UI가 닫히면 프로그램은 이 설정을 수집하고 해당 스크립트를 생성하여 Flow 프로젝트에 직접 통합합니다. 프로젝트가 실행되어 TMscript Node에 도달하면 이 스크립트가 실행되어 커스텀 동작을 수행합니다. TMcraft Node는 유연성을 높일 뿐만 아니라 TMflow 환경 내에서 고도로 전문화된 워크플로 개발을 간소화합니다.

TMcraft Toolbar
TMcraft Toolbar는 TMflow 내에서 효율성과 사용자 경험을 향상시키기 위해 설계된 유연한 플러그인 아키텍처(C# 및 WPF 기반)입니다. Flow 프로젝트에 종속된 TMcraft Node와 달리 TMcraft Toolbar는 독립적으로 작동하며 TMflow 전반에서 활용할 수 있습니다. 이 커스텀 가능한 UI 프로그램은 장치 제어 패널 역할을 하여 사용자가 애플리케이션 내의 장치를 관리하고 조작할 수 있는 직관적인 인터페이스를 제공합니다. 또한 TMcraft Toolbar는 보조 데이터 디스플레이로서 인사이트를 제공하거나 특정 시스템과 원활하게 상호 작용하는 커뮤니케이터 역할을 할 수 있습니다. TMcraft Toolbar는 최종 사용자가 작업을 더 효율적으로 수행할 수 있도록 지원하며, 워크플로 최적화 및 TMflow 기능 향상을 위한 유용한 도구입니다.

TMcraft Service
TMflow는 다양한 기능을 제공하지만 모든 요구 사항을 충족하지 못하는 한계가 있을 수 있습니다. 이러한 경우 개발자는 TMcraft Service를 생성하는 것이 좋습니다. TMcraft Service는 TMflow 프로젝트, TMcraft 플러그인 또는 외부 장치와 상호 작용하여 광범위한 작업을 수행할 수 있는 백그라운드 프로그램입니다. 개발자는 C# 또는 C++를 사용하여 TMcraft Service를 프로그래밍함으로써 아이디어를 실현하고 TM AI Cobot의 기능을 확장할 수 있습니다.
TMcraft Setup
TMflow에 임베딩된 혁신적인 플러그인 아키텍처(C# 및 WPF 기반)인 TMcraft Setup을 소개합니다. 이는 Flow 프로젝트의 기능을 향상시키도록 설계되었습니다. 커스텀 가능한 UI 프로그램 역할을 하는 TMcraft Setup을 통해 개발자는 장치 관리를 위한 직관적인 제어 패널을 생성하여 사용자 상호 작용을 간소화할 수 있습니다. 하지만 TMcraft Setup의 진정한 차별점은 프로젝트 초기화를 정의하고 자동화하는 능력입니다. TMcraft Setup UI를 통해 애플리케이션을 구성함으로써 최종 사용자는 특정 설정을 입력할 수 있으며, 프로그램은 이를 컴파일하여 실행 시 프로젝트를 초기화하는 스크립트로 변환합니다. 이 기능은 각 프로젝트가 필요한 정밀한 구성으로 시작되도록 보장하여, TMcraft Setup을 워크플로 효율성 최적화 및 특정 요구 사항에 맞춘 로봇 애플리케이션 제작에 필수적인 도구로 만듭니다.

TMcraft Shell
TMcraft Shell은 개발자가 전체 페이지 UI 프로그램을 생성하여 TMflow에 직접 임베딩할 수 있는 강력한 플러그인 아키텍처(C# 및 WPF 기반)입니다. TMcraft Shell을 사용하면 완전히 커스텀된 UI/UX를 통해 간소화되고 직관적인 구성 프로세스를 제공하는 애플리케이션 설정 마법사(Application Setup Wizard)를 설계하여 최종 사용자가 복잡한 애플리케이션을 쉽게 설정하도록 도울 수 있습니다. TMcraft Shell 프로그램은 모든 사용자 구성을 수집하고 해당 스크립트 프로젝트를 자동으로 생성하여 원활한 통합을 보장합니다. 또한 TMcraft Shell은 맞춤형 대시보드를 생성하는 데 사용할 수 있으며, 개발자는 데이터 표시를 위한 인터페이스나 애플리케이션에 대한 인사이트 및 제어를 제공하는 경량 제어 패널을 설계할 수 있습니다. TMcraft Shell은 개발자가 사용자 경험과 기능을 향상시켜 로봇을 더욱 다재다능하고 사용자 친화적인 도구로

궁금한 점
작동 방식: TMcraft API
TMcraft API는 커스텀 플러그인과 TMflow 간의 원활한 상호 작용을 가능하게 하도록 설계된 강력한 C# 인터페이스입니다. API를 통해 변수를 읽고 쓰며, I/O를 제어하고, 플러그인 내에서 직접 로봇을 조그 구동할 수도 있습니다. 이 인터페이스는 무한한 가능성을 열어주며, 개발자가 TMflow의 핵심 기능과 긴밀하게 통합된 정교한 맞춤형 솔루션을 만들 수 있도록 합니다. 고급 제어 시스템을 구축하든 직관적인 사용자 인터페이스를 생성하든, TMcraft API는 아이디어를 정밀하고 효율적으로 실현하는 데 필요한 도구를 제공합니다.
시작하기: TMcraft Development Kit
TMcraft Development Kit는 플러그인 제작을 마스터하는 데 필요한 모든 필수 리소스가 포함된 포괄적인 패키지입니다.
포함된 내용:
• TMcraft APIs: 다양한 버전의 API가 동적 링크 라이브러리(.dll)로 제공됩니다.
• TMcraft Packer: 플러그인의 프로그램 파일을 패키징하여 올바른 형식으로 TMflow에 가져올 수 있도록 준비하는 필수 도구입니다.
• 문서: 개발 과정을 쉽게 진행할 수 있도록 돕는 상세한 API 매뉴얼, 단계별 튜토리얼 및 참조 가이드입니다.
• 소스 코드 예제: 다양한 TMcraft 플러그인에 대한 기본 개발 기술과 특정 사용 사례를 보여주는 코드 샘플 모음입니다.
TMcraft Development Kit를 사용하면 TMflow를 위한 강력한 확장 기능을 구축하는 데 필요한 지식과 도구를 갖추게 됩니다. 다운로드 센터에서 키트를 다운로드하십시오.








